And here it be, the Securitron from New Vegas now running on a slightly modified version of the original skeleton.
[code]Features:
-Bodygrouped whatever! (i.e. Exhaust vents, fingers, gatling laser, 9mm SMG, and missiles)
-Skingrouped monitors!
-Fingerposing of some sorts! (Will require bodygroup and joint tool to get working as intended)
-4 models! (Clean/regular, dirty/regular, clean/missile, dirty/missile)
